South Korean firms Korea Midland Power Co (KOMIPO), Korea Southern Power Co (KOSPO) and SK subsidiary PRISM Energy International have issued a tender for one liquefied natural gas (LNG) cargo for delivery in June.According to a tender issued by KOMIPO, which is leading the tender process, the buyers are seeking 3-3.6 trillion British thermal units (Btu) of LNG on a JKM-linked and delivered ex-ship (DES) basis.The cargo is to be delivered on June 12 or June 23 to one of the Kogas-operated terminals in Incheon, Pyeongtaek, Tongyeong and Samcheok in Korea.The JKM, or Japan-Korea-Marker, is the LN
